The Cliff College Committee, our governing board, is seeking new members with senior level experience of management or governance, including backgrounds in estates management, marketing or the hospitality industry as well as other relevant areas. Applications from women and members of ethnic minorities are strongly encouraged.
\r\nWe are a Methodist foundation at the leading edge of teaching evangelism, emerging church and other mission areas. Our 250 students from a wide range of denominations study at undergraduate, postgraduate and doctoral levels, with our degree courses validated by Manchester University. We also run a Conference Centre offering catered accommodation and facilities to large numbers.
\r\nApplications are invited by 31st December 2010 from individuals who are fully in sympathy with our values, share our commitment and excitement about what we do, and can demonstrate appropriate experience. The posts are not remunerated but expenses are met. The Committee meets three times annually at the College in Derbyshire.
